Umpire Does John Cena’s ‘You Can’t See Me’ In A CPL Match While Imran Tahir Was Bowling: Watch

1 years ago By Sports Desk

In the heat of cricket action, moments of light-heartedness and humor often steal the spotlight, reminding fans that the game is not just about fierce competition but also about camaraderie and fun. One such delightful incident occurred during a Caribbean Premier League (CPL) match between Guyana Amazon Warriors (GAW) and Trinbago Knight Riders (TKR). While TKR emerged victorious, it was a playful moment involving umpires and Imran Tahir that charmed the cricketing world.

The CPL is known for its thrilling encounters, and the Qualifier 1 clash between GAW and TKR was no exception. Imran Tahir, the seasoned leg-spinner and GAW skipper, decided to bring his skills into play during the powerplay, setting the stage for an unexpected twist.

John Cena’s Iconic Gesture:

As Tahir prepared to bowl the fifth over of TKR’s innings, anticipation filled the air. The first delivery he unleashed was nothing short of mesmerizing. It deceived the batsman, who attempted a sweep shot but missed, with the ball striking his pads. A fervent appeal for an LBW decision echoed across the field.

However, the on-field umpire found himself in a peculiar situation. For a brief moment, he lost sight of the ball’s trajectory amid the confusion. Unable to make an immediate decision, he paused, temporarily unsure about the outcome.

It was at this precise moment that Imran Tahir decided to infuse the scene with humor. Channeling his inner showman, he performed an iconic gesture that took everyone by surprise – the famous “You Can’t See Me” move, made famous by professional wrestler John Cena. Tahir’s playful taunt brought an unexpected twist to the situation, leaving spectators and players both in stitches.

The Decision Review System (DRS) Comes into Play:

Amid the laughter and amusement that rippled through the stadium, both teams opted for the Decision Review System (DRS). This review would determine the fate of the perplexed batsman. As the DRS process unfolded, the crowd waited with bated breath to see if the decision would uphold the LBW appeal.

Following a meticulous review, the DRS rendered its judgment. The verdict was in favor of GAW, much to the delight of their supporters. The batsman, though reluctantly, accepted the decision and trudged back to the pavilion.
